Default Custom Excel Entry Form

Is there a way to create a custom form in Excel that looks like something in
MS Word where you can enter any kind of data then automatically go to the
next data entry cell? I know you can create an entry form but I believe you
need to have all the column names adjacent to each other in the same row or
in one column sequencially. I'm thinking of the flexibility to enter data
like in A2 then after pressing the Enter key going to another cell not
adjacent to Cell A2. Maybe I just need to figure out how to do it in MS Word
but I wanted to do it in Excel if it is possible.
